Output 24b95ffd050dfab077889e657a79a587ab26e87124b8c948882ce5950644ef15:0

value
4899
script pubkey
OP_0 OP_PUSHBYTES_20 68efa6d0a2bda3619dcac818efb4a987085e2c2a
address
bc1qdrh6d59zhk3kr8w2eqvwld9fsuy9utp2dh8tt4
transaction
24b95ffd050dfab077889e657a79a587ab26e87124b8c948882ce5950644ef15
confirmations
118008
spent
true